markguinn/silverstripe-wishlist

Silverstripe Shop 的愿望清单子模块。

安装: 255

依赖: 0

建议者: 0

安全: 0

星标: 3

关注者: 3

分支: 2

开放问题: 1

类型:silverstripe-module

1.0.0 2014-07-31 15:53 UTC

This package is not auto-updated.

Last update: 2024-09-14 15:16:27 UTC


README

允许客户维护多个愿望清单。可以从前端页面的愿望清单页面进行维护。最初支持 ss-shop 和电子商务模块,但现在电子商务支持仅限于“agnostic”和“ecommerce”分支。对于持续的功能,我选择专注于 ss-shop。

用法

通过 composer (markguinn/silverstripe-wishlist) 或传统方式安装模块。将以下内容添加到 mysite/_config/config.yml 中

Product:
  extensions:
    - CanAddToWishList

请确保 dev/build?flush=1。您可以将此扩展添加到任何可购买模型。它应该与非 sitetree 模型一起工作,但这尚未经过测试。

您可能需要包含 WishListButtons.ss 模板或更新您现有的一个模板,以符合本模块中包含的模板。

待办事项

  • 从产品页面添加到备选列表
  • 产品页面 Ajax 化
  • 在 CMS 中查看
  • "保存一个想法" 功能
  • 公开/私密列表
  • 通过链接分享
  • 应用到产品变体并测试

开发者

欢迎提交拉取请求。遵循 Silverstripe 编码规范。

许可 (MIT)

版权所有 (c) 2013 Mark Guinn

特此授予任何人免费获得本软件及其相关文档文件(“软件”)的副本(“软件”),在软件中不受限制地处理,包括但不限于使用、复制、修改、合并、发布、分发、再许可和/或出售软件副本的权利,并允许获得软件的人这样做,但受以下条件约束

上述版权声明和本许可声明应包含在软件的所有副本或主要部分中。

软件按“原样”提供,不提供任何形式的保证,明示或暗示,包括但不限于适销性、针对特定目的的适用性和非侵权性。在任何情况下,作者或版权所有者均不对任何索赔、损害或其他责任负责,无论此类索赔、损害或其他责任是基于合同、侵权或其他方式,源于、因之或与软件或其使用或其他方式相关。